However, the global position of the Philippines in aquaculture production has fallen steadily from 4 th place in 1985 to 12 th place today. The Philippines now contributes only a little over one percent of global farmed fish production compared to five percent previously. In 2010 and 2011, the country was the biggest rice importer. Private consumption was the main growth driver, as growth recovered to 5.8% year-on-year in the first half of 2019 from 5.3% during the same period last year, driven by moderating inflation, steady remittance inflows, an improving job market, and an increase in economic activity from election-related spending. Its rice imports amounted to 2.38 million t in 2010, mostly coming from Vietnam and Thailand.
